Release by Eda daughter of Serlo, to the abbey and canons of St Andrew's, Osolveston, of all her right in land in Scaldeford (Scalford) which she claimed against them by the king's writ of right. Witnesses:- William de Folevill', William de Martivaus, and others (named). Leicestershire
